Your way by the Vapor
The initial metal-hulled steam vessels generated your way to help you Australian continent when you look at the 1852. not, these types of very early steamers, labeled as auxiliaries, nevertheless carried a full gang of sails, as their unproductive motors and the shortage of coaling slots dentro de approach to Australia avoided the application of the latest vapor technology over-long ranges.
Although the rates was not initially improved of the advent of vapor, spirits and you can fuel had been. The change of antique solid wood hulled vessels to help you metal hulls allowed steamships are huge and stronger, with far better space below the decks.
From the 1860s the more efficient substance steam-engine, in which steam is actually expanded inside the straight cylinders, try brought. It let vessels to really make the trip so you’re able to Australian continent completely less than vapor fuel. However, it wasn’t before 1880s following regarding an authorities post subsidy, one vapor vessels turned into effective and you can started initially to bring most of immigrants. Reduced based upon into snap, it travelled during the a stable price and you can offered stamina to own electronic lights, refrigeration and you will ventilation. Grand saloons were able to be offered to own world-class people, and short cabins rather than asleep berths had been considering in the steerage category.
Navigating the journey
Navigating the brand new route to Australia is an elaborate task, requiring great skill on the part of the brand new ship’s head, in addition to accessibility certain navigational gadgets. These included the fresh new telescope, marine compass, ship’s log and sextant. Yet not, routing has also been determined by the brand new ship’s master having a performing experience in the positioning of your own superstars about nights sky.
Telescopes have been an essential product out of ining sightings of belongings far more closely and for identifying boats passed on the way. It was particularly important in times of war.
The compass try a tool used for determining the brand new guidelines in hence a boat is travel. It consists of a honestly swinging magnetised needle, and therefore implies magnetic north.
The development of iron hulled boats for instance the The uk authored complications for the utilization of the compass. The newest steel on the hull of them ships tampered into the behaviour of the magnetic needle, requiring special improvements and you can calculations to be made for appropriate indication.
Charts and you will routing charts were produced by new Admiralty towards access to United kingdom naval and merchant ships. Outline and reliability have been very important, and several continue to be used now. Charts and you will charts was basically usually kept in the new chartroom aboard the vessel.
A great sextant is an astronomical device used in delivering latitude indication, because of the calculating this new position off height of sunshine, moon or a superstar over the opinions within sea.
An excellent chronometer was a timepiece that is capable continue precise date up to speed ship. They enables sailors so you can determine longitude because of the observing the career from certain stars throughout the air from the certain moments, and you can evaluating the observations into data contained in an effective nautical almanac.
Good Ship’s Diary looked very similar to good torpedo however, was familiar with measure the price out of a boat. Whenever dragged at the rear of this new vessel, course off water beyond the propeller triggered they so you’re able to switch, turning the little needle dials so you can listing the distance and you can price flew.
